【问题标题】:Error in Parent-Child relationship : The source attribute of the level is marked as 'Parent'父子关系错误:关卡的源属性标记为“父”
【发布时间】:2021-03-08 19:17:35
【问题描述】:

我正在尝试在我的 SSAS 项目中定义父子关系。维度是“员工”,父级是“主管”。我的数据源是从教授提供的 .bak 文件中自动导入的,但我觉得它可能以某种方式被损坏或我做错了什么。

我在处理过程中遇到的错误:

Level [Sprzedawca].[Subordinate Hierarchy].[Supervisor] : The source attribute of the level is marked as 'Parent'

我将主管的属性用法设置为“父级”。 Id Sprzedawcy(卖方 ID)和主管的列名都是“ImieiNazwisko”(NameAndSurname),这是源数据中的一个属性,但没有自动移动到属性(左列) - 我不确定我是否应该把它拖到那里吗?无论如何,这也无济于事......

【问题讨论】:

    标签: sql ssas parent-child dimensions


    【解决方案1】:

    当您将属性使用设置为属性的父级时,会自动创建父子层次结构,并且标记为父属性的属性不能用作用户定义的层次结构中的级别。

    所以要解决你的问题,你只需要删除你创建的“下级层次结构”的层次结构,事情就会完美地工作。

    【讨论】:

    • 太棒了!非常感谢您的回答。在我们从教授那里得到的指令中,将属性用法设置为父级并将其添加为用户定义的层次结构中的一个级别都存在。当我在寻找解决方案时,我实际上删除了这个层次结构,我可以处理多维数据集。感谢您的解释,现在一切都清楚了!
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多